Ep 6 was recorded in Copenhagen with Mikael Colville-Andersen: urban planner, activist, host of the TV series The Life-Sized City and the author of Copenhagenize - The Definitive Guide To Global Bicycle Urbanism.
He's also behind the Bikes4Ukraine initiative.
We talk about:
-Copenhagen, of course, but also Barcelona, Paris, Brussels, Montreal and others
-cycle chic and the arrogance of space
-the better choice between a dumb city and a "smart city"
-what are modern cobblestones and sponge parks
-the joys of sidewalk life
-how to communicate the reallocation of urban space: ask or don't ask the citizens
-why cities are more influential than climate summits
-the analog gift of the pandemic
-how to get from 2% cycling share in a city to 10% in one year
-bikes in war and disaster zones
-the US disappointment and the car hell in the center of Europe
-participatory democracy at street level, new people’s movements
-the age of urbanism after the car dictatorship
-how a metro is not always a great idea
-why even Denmark still has a problem with cars

Episode 5 of Collective Choices was recorded in the Carpathian Mountains, in Transylvania, Romania. Christoph Promberger is the executive director of Foundation Conservation Carpathia.
We talk about:
-the story behind the biggest national park Europe will soon have
-fighting the government and the timber mafia
-what do you do when you receive a forest
-why a conservation project would have a hunting association and would sponsor a football club
-why Romania should be your next eco-tourism destination
-how lack of long term vision affects economic growth for generations
-how distrust endangers conservation efforts and why it’s worth believing in exceptional people
-getting along with bison and bears
-when Western Europe is not a good example to follow and when poorer countries have a lot to offer
-why you need (some) development in a nature reserve
-cute animal videos

Ep. 7 of Collective Choices was recorded in Uppsala, Sweden, with Marie Pellas, mobility expert and winner of the Traffic Award for 2023.
We talk about:
- how do you win a traffic award
- living an (almost) car free life with kids
- how the size of a city, its design and the options available influence travel choices
- you need infrastructure to change behaviors, but you have to feel the change before you know you want it
- how politicians are open to build new infrastructure, but not to prioritize differently in the existing one
- why the planners should navigate the city without their car
- a mother’s experience with the beg button
- trying to explain to children why the infrastructure is against them and why they are blamed
- how municipalities reacted to the energy prices and why the attitude will change regarding the transportation sector as well
